A New PC-SAFT Model for Pure Water, Water–Hydrocarbons, and Water–Oxygenates Systems and Subsequent Modeling of VLE, VLLE, and LLE

Volume: 61, Issue: 12, Pages: 4178 - 4190
Published: Nov 10, 2016
Abstract
Accurate analytic thermodynamic modeling of water and its mixtures with hydrocarbon and oxygenates is difficult even with new and advanced equations of state such as the perturbed-chain statistical associating fluid theory (PC-SAFT). Several attempts have been made in the past by various authors to solve this issue.
